Former Albanian Traffic Police Chief Acquitted of Corruption
Albania's Special Court against Corruption and Organized Crime (GJKKO) acquitted former head of Traffic Police Roven Zeka of passive corruption charges due to insufficient evidence. Two other individuals received sentences in the same case.
